The invention discloses an electromagnet control method, system and device, a maglev train and a readable storage medium, and relates to the technical field of magnetic levitation, the electromagnet control method is applied to a controller, and the electromagnet control method comprises the steps that first current of a first electromagnet and second current of a second electromagnet corresponding to a lap joint structure of the maglev train are obtained, the first electromagnet and the controller are located in the same single-point suspension system, and the second electromagnet and the controller are located in different single-point suspension systems. Judging whether the lap joint structure meets a current balance condition based on the first current and the second current; if not, the suspension gap of the first electromagnet and/or the second electromagnet is adjusted, so that the lap joint structure meets the current balance condition. The lap joint structure can achieve current balance, the problem that heating is obvious due to the fact that current of a single electromagnet is too large is solved, and long-time operation of a maglev train is facilitated.
